Unfortunately, I was partially spoiled, because when I Googled the episode to see if anyone subbed it yet, I saw the sentence "Lelouch has the code" and the impact of Lelouch's 'death' was ruined.

I'm happy that Lelouch and C.C. are going to be able to leave in peace [for eternity].
I don't see how people did not know that Zero was Suzaku. Who else in Code Geass can outmaneuver a machine gun? I'm really hoping for a third season, although Lelouch/C.C.'s immortality wouldn't bode well with a third season. I personally think that it's possible for another storyline using Code Geass, but with new characters, similar to how the Gundam series works.